
Stars Select 11 Players in Phase I Draft
Published on May 3, 2016 under United States Hockey League (USHL)
Lincoln Stars News Release
Lincoln, Neb. - The Stars selected eight forwards and three defensemen in the Phase I USHL Draft on Tuesday night.
The ten-round Phase I Draft consisted of 2000 birth year players. Below is a breakdown of the players selected and storylines from the draft.

STORYLINES
-The Stars used their first-round Phase I selection to tender defenseman Christian Krygier, then picked his twin brother, Cole, in the fifth round of the Phase I Draft.
-The Stars drafted Max Johnson, son of former Stars coach Steve Johnson, in the ninth round of the Phase I Draft. Steve coached in Lincoln for 11 seasons and won two (2) Clark Cups.
-Fourth-round pick Wyatt Schlaht survived a brain hemorrhage in 2015. Story
-The Stars selected six players with fathers who played in the National Hockey League. Christian, Cole Krygier (sons of Todd), Jack McBain (son of Andrew), Zach Dubinsky (son of Steve), Trevor Peca (son of Mike), Philippe Lapointe (son of Martin)
-Zach Dubinsky's father, Steve, was coached by coach Chris Hartsburg's father, Craig, with the Chicago Blackhawks from 1995-1998
-The Stars selected players from eight (8) teams: Little Caesars (3), Chicago Mission (2), St. Sebastian's School (1), Colorado Thunderbirds (1), Team North Dakota (1), EC Salzburg (1), Buffalo Jr. Sabres (1), Don Mills Flyers (1)
-Where They're From: Michigan (3), Illinois (2), Canada (2), Boston (1), New York (1), North Dakota (1), Colorado (1)
The Stars are set to participate in the USHL Phase II Draft on Wednesday, May 3 beginning at 8 am. Players with birth years between 1996-2000 will be available in the Phase II Draft.
The Stars will make their Phase II selections until they've filled their initial 45-man protected list - holding affiliate players, Phase I and Phase II selections.
